Founded in 1853, the California Academy of Sciences is a leading science institute dedicated to regenerating the natural world through science, learning, and collaboration. From the 1.4 million visitors who walk through its doors each year to the 46 million scientific specimens in its collection, the Academy’s impact starts at its museum in San Francisco, California and reaches far across the globe through scientific research, public engagement and environmental literacy programs, digital media, and sustainability education.
